Abstract

The utility model discloses an automobile tail door cover plate die, which comprises a punch press, wherein the lower end surface of the punch press is fixedly connected with an upper die, a bottom plate is arranged below the punch press, the upper end surface of the bottom plate is fixedly connected with a lower die, the upper end surface of the lower die is provided with a die cavity, the interior of the lower die is provided with a cooling cavity, the right side of the cooling cavity is provided with a water outlet pipe, the right side of the water outlet pipe is communicated with a second connecting port, cooling water cools a stamping part in the die cavity, the part can be cooled and cooled in time, the working efficiency is improved, a water pump is opened, the water in the cooling cavity is pumped out by the water pump and is sprayed out by a spray gun, a user can spray the die by the spray gun to clean, the influence of impurities on the stamping effect is avoided, the problem that the existing automobile tail door cover, meanwhile, when the die is used for a long time, impurities are easily left in the stamping of the upper die and the lower die, and the cleaning is inconvenient.

In order to hang the spray gun inside the fixing hole, it is preferable as an automobile tail gate cover plate mold of this embodiment: the diameter of the fixing hole is larger than that of the spray gun and smaller than that of the limiting ball.
For the convenience of injecting cooling water into the cooling cavity, the automobile tail gate cover plate mold of the embodiment is preferably: the left side of lower mould is provided with the inlet tube, the right side and the cooling chamber intercommunication of inlet tube, the left side of inlet tube is provided with first connector.
In order to improve the cooling effect, it is preferable as an automobile tail gate cover plate mold of this embodiment: and a refrigerating sheet is arranged at the bottom end inside the cooling cavity.
In order to improve the supporting effect of the bottom plate, the automobile tail gate cover plate mold of the embodiment is preferably: the bottom plate is made of stainless steel.
In order to flexibly adjust the spraying angle of the spray gun, the automobile tail door cover plate mold is preferred as the following: the conduit is a plastic hose.
In order to drive the upper die stamping lower die, the automobile tail door cover plate die is preferred as the embodiment: and a driving cylinder is arranged on the upper end surface of the punch.

As a technical optimization scheme of the utility model, the diameter of fixed orifices 16 is greater than the diameter of spray gun 14 and is less than the diameter of spacing ball 15.
In this embodiment: the diameter of fixed orifices 16 is greater than the diameter of spray gun 14, and the convenience is inside inserting fixed orifices 16 with spray gun 14, and the diameter of fixed orifices 16 is less than the diameter of spacing ball 15, conveniently blocks on fixed orifices 16 top through spacing ball 15 to it is fixed with spray gun 14, the convenience of taking.
As a technical optimization scheme of the utility model, the left side of lower mould 4 is provided with inlet tube 7, and inlet tube 7's right side and cooling chamber 6 intercommunication, inlet tube 7's left side are provided with first connector 8.
In this embodiment: through first interface 8 and outside pipeline intercommunication, the cooling water conveniently adds the cooling water in getting into cooling chamber 6 through inlet tube 7.
As a technical optimization scheme of the utility model, the refrigeration piece 18 is installed to the inside bottom in cooling chamber 6.
In this embodiment: the cooling water, which has been raised in the cooling operation temperature, is cooled again by the cooling fins 18, so that the next group of parts is cooled.
As a technical optimization scheme of the utility model, the bottom plate 3 is stainless steel.
In this embodiment: the bottom plate 3 plays a supporting role, and has a large impact force when the upper die 2 punches the lower die 4, and the bottom plate 3 made of stainless steel has high structural strength and high hardness, and can well support the lower die 4.
As a technical optimization scheme of the utility model, the conduit 11 is a plastic hose.
In this embodiment: the plastic hose is good in flexibility, and when the spray gun 14 is used for cleaning a mold, the angle of the spray gun 14 can be flexibly adjusted, so that cleaning is convenient.
As a technical optimization scheme of the utility model, the up end of punch press 1 is installed and is driven actuating cylinder 17.
In this embodiment: the driving cylinder 17 provides power for the upper die 2 to drive the upper die 2 to punch the lower die 4 for punching.
